الوصل يتلقى خسارة مفاجئة أمام الجزيرة 3 -2

Al Wasl lost to Al Jazira 3-2 in the match held at Zayed City Sports Stadium, in the 13th round of the ADNOC Pro League.

Al Wasl started the game conservatively and created a numerical intensity in the middle of the field, not to make any space available to Al Jazira players, but in the 13th minute the Emperor received the first goal from a shot from inside the penalty area shot by Khalifa al-Hammadi, who took advantage of the wrong positioning of Al Wasl defenders.

Al Wasl then intensified his attempts and almost scored the equaliser through a chance for Michel Araujo, who received a magic pass from Fabio de Lima, among the defenders of the Al Jazira, to single out the goal but slowed down to intervene the Al Jazira defender and turn the ball into a corner, and in the 25th minute Ramiro Benetti, a powerful shot from outside the penalty area, was countered by Ali Khasif, with difficulty.

With the 35th minute, Al Wasl became more in control of the game and managed to equalise through the brilliant Michel Araujo, who converted Fabio's pass from the right to a one-touch goal on ali Khasif's right, in the 38th minute, ending the first half with a positive draw.

At the beginning of the second half, the Emperor succeeded in surprising Al Jazira, and scored a second goal through Ali Saleh "Golden Boy", who took advantage of a huge defensive error from the defender of the home team, to place the ball in the net easily in the 46th minute.

With the 58th minute the emperor tightened his grip on the meeting and almost consolidated his lead with a third goal, after a wonderful team work but Araujo, wasting the opportunity in front of a near-empty goal, to keep the result yellow 2-0.

In the 74th minute, the home team managed to equalise in the 70th minute from a shot outside the penalty area, with Odier Hillman making the first of the substitutions with brazilian striker Gilberto Oliveira, instead of Mtafo Owlabi, to increase the pressure on the home owners to score a third goal.

From a quick counterattack, the home team succeeded in adding a third goal in the 80th minute through Ahmed Fawzi, to push Hillman with a second switch with the entry of Mohamed Al-Akabri instead of Ali Salemin, in an attempt to equalise, to end the meeting with a 3-2 loss.
